About Oregon Health & Science University

The Oregon Health and Sciences University (OHSU) – located in Portland, Oregon – stands as a prominent research institution dedicated to advancing health sciences education and practice. Established in 1887, O UHS boasts a rich history deeply intertwined with the region’s healthcare landscape. The university's mission centers on producing highly qualified professionals while simultaneously contributing significantly to innovation within the field. OHSU is currently ranked amongst the top universities in the nation by U.S. News & World Report, consistently holding a position of 324th in respect to its state and continent rank.

The university’s strength lies particularly in nursing, radiologic technology, and public health. O UHS offers specialized programs that have been instrumental in shaping healthcare professionals across Oregon and beyond.
